IJburg cloud sightings to inspire neighborhood artwork

Residents are being invited to photograph shapes they spot in the sky above the district. Their submissions will help shape a new public art installation by Yasser Ballemans.

A new neighborhood art project titled Wolken van IJburg invites local residents to look up at the sky and spot shapes in passing clouds. The community ideas will serve as the foundation for an artwork created by artist Yasser Ballemans.

Locals can photograph unusual cloud formations above IJburg and submit them with a note describing the figure, animal, or symbol they see. Beyond sending photos, residents will also participate directly in developing the final design.

Community workshops and submissions

The project is an initiative of Kunst op IJburg, organized alongside Stichting Natuurlijk IJburg, Factor IJ, and Ballemans. Organizers aim to encourage neighborhood connection as well as creativity.

Residents can participate through an online photo campaign or attend upcoming workshops hosted at local schools, community centers, and cultural venue Factor IJ. These sessions will explore the shapes and stories people find overhead.

Selecting the final design

A weighted lottery will assemble a diverse working group of IJburgers to collaborate directly with the artist and project organizers. This group will help decide how the submitted cloud figures are incorporated into the finished piece.

Because the design will develop directly from community contributions, its final appearance remains open. Once the design phase concludes, organizers will need to secure sponsors and funding before the artwork can be built.
